Kuwait- 'Selfish' woman loses custody of estate


(MENAFN- Arab Times) The Court of First Instance sanctioned the decision of a Kuwaiti citizen to retrieve the estate he had given to his former wife by deleting her name from the Real Estate Registration Department due to alleged infidelity and discontinuity of marital relations through divorce



According to the plaintiff counsel Lawyer Ali Al- Asfour, his client naturalized his Arab wife after their marriage and gave her half of his estate. However, he was shocked when her attitude changed later and she became troublesome and unfaithful. She created many problems for him, and used the documents he gave her to claim huge amounts of money from him and file a divorce



Lawyer Al-Asfour expressed his appreciation for the judicial decision, saying it stood firm against opportunism whereby some people think others are stupid and capitalize on their kindness to exploit them. He affirmed that the woman exposed her motives for marrying his client, which were solely for monetary gain and obtaining Kuwaiti citizenship, forgetting that the law would take its course one day
